Cómo trasladar Wordpress de servidor sin plugins

Trasladar Wordpress de servidor sin utilizar plugins no es una tarea difícil ni reservada a personas con conocimientos avanzados de informática.

De hecho, es un procedimiento bastante fácil y sencillo si se siguen unas pautas y se toman unas medidas de seguridad básicas que impidan posibles errores.

Probablemente si haces una búsqueda en Google de información sobre cómo trasladar wordpress de hosting encuentres muchos artículos con información al respecto.

Casi todos te hablarán de los mejores plugins para trasladar Wordpress de servidor, incluso se cuelen entre los resultados artículos sobre plugins para hacer una copia completa de Wordpress.

Para muchos, utilizar un plugin para hacer una copia completa de una web y utilizarla para trasladar e instalar la web en otro servidor quizás sea lo más fácil.

Pero en mi caso, al probar estos plugins, la copia se ha demorado muchísimo, cosa que suele suceder con webs de gran tamaño, o el servidor donde se pretende alojar la web no acepta subidas de este tamaño desde el navegador.

Yo os voy a explicar, paso a paso, cómo trasladar Wordpress de servidor de forma manual, sin errores y sin problemas, y además dejar solo aquellas tablas de la base de datos que en realidad necesitamos.

Elegir el mejor hosting para mi web

No voy a entrar en el eterno debate de analizar cuál es el mejor hosting para una web. Ya existen en internet muchísimos artículos sobre ese tema.

Lo único que os recomiendo es que valoreis lo que vuestro actual hosting os ofrece y lo que en realidad necesitáis o necesita vuestra web.

Yo al principio me fijaba principalmente en el precio, pero con el tiempo he llegado a la conclusión de que merece la pena pagar un poco más para obtener unas prestaciones un poco mejores si tu proyecto web es serio.

Durante muchos años he tenido mis webs alojadas en Banahosting, un servicio de hosting con servidores en Holanda, bastante decente y que permite alojar varias páginas y dominio, con transferencia y espacio en disco ilimitados.

Además disponen de sistema de afiliados lo que te va a permitir ir rebajando el precio anual de la renovación de tu alojamiento.

Ahora, por cuestiones técnicas he decidido trasladar una de mis web a otro servidor como es Webempresa, un servicio de hosting especializado en Wordpress, muy afamado y con unas prestaciones un poco superior.

Cómo hacer una copia de una página web

Lo primero que vamos a hacer antes de trasladar Wordpress de servidor es un backup de nuestra página web, es decir, hacer una copia de seguridad de Wordpress que será la que utilicemos para realizar el traslado.

Vas a leer muchos artículos sobre plugins para hacer copias de Wordpress y puede que en tu caso sean de ayuda.

Trasladar wordpress de servidor
Estructura de la bases de datos

Yo personalmente he decidido hacer las copias de seguridad de forma manual, básicamente por que al ser un blog de mucho tamaño, el archivo resultante al utilizar un plugin sería muy pesado para subir a un hosting.

Además quiero realizar una instalación limpia de Wordpress, es decir, mantener solo las tablas de la bases de datos necesarias, ya que al ir utilizando distintos plugins en todos estos años, la base de datos contiene tablas obsoletas o que no se utilizan.

Lo primero es acceder vía FTP a nuestro hosting, entrar en la ruta donde se guardan los archivos de nuestra web y descargar a nuestro equipo la carpeta «uploads» que contiene todos los archivos incrustados en nuestros artículos (fotos y fotos destacadas). La carpeta se encuentra en la ruta raiz/wp-content/uploads.

Si has creado alguna otra carpeta donde guardas archivos necesarios para tu web también debes descargarla.

Realizar una instalación limpia de Wordpress

Como os he comentado, el propósito de trasladar Wordpress de servidor a otro como es Webempresa no solo es por mejorar el servicio, también pretendo hacer una instalación limpia de Wordpress.

Webempresa, al igual que muchos servicios de Hospedaje web, ofrecen la posibilidad de instalar automáticamente Wordpress.

Esta es la forma más rápida y simple de hacerlo, pero yo he optado por hacer la instalación de forma manual, para mantener el prefijo de las tablas de la base de datos e ir cambiando esas tablas por las copias realizadas.

Antes de realizar cualquier instalación hay que crear una base de datos en nuestro nuevo hosting y un usuario asociado a dicha base de datos ya que lo necesitaremos para completar la instalación de Wordpress.

Además, al darnos de alta en Webempresa, hemos seleccionado la opción de utilizar un dominio ya existente con lo que el alta se hace configurando todos los parámetros para que solo tengamos que apuntar el dominio a nuestro nuevo hosting.

Para hacer una instalación limpia de Wordpress de forma manual, descargamos desde Wordpress los archivos de instalación y seguimos sus instrucciones de instalación.

Restaurar copia de seguridad de Wordpress

Una vez que tenemos terminada la instalación de Wordpress en nuestro nuevo servidor, debemos comenzar con el proceso para trasladar Wordpress de servidor subiendo a la misma ruta la carpeta «uploads» que descargamos al equipo.

Ahora comenzamos con el proceso que quizás sea más complicado, aunque en realidad es tan sencillo como sustituir tablas de una base de datos.

Primero hacemos una copia de la base de datos de la nueva instalación. A continuación, tomamos nota de las tablas de datos de esa nueva instalación y las eliminamos excepto la tabla wp-options.

En la antigua base de datos, bajamos las tablas que de las que hemos tomado nota, excepto wp-options y las subimos a la nueva base de datos.

Ahora, si accedemos a nuestra instalación limpia de Wordpress, comprobaremos que ya están todas nuestras páginas y artículos.

Llega el turno para los plugins. Aquí he seguido el mismo procedimiento que anteriormente, es decir, instalar plugin, borrar sus tablas y subir las tablas del otro servidor.

Por lo tanto, subimos uno de los plugins y comprobamos si ha creado tablas en nuestra nueva base de datos. Si es así, las borramos, descargamos esas tablas de la antigua instalación y subimos a la nueva.

Una vez que hemos procedido con todos los plugins, tendremos que sustituir el theme, si es que utilizas una plantilla determinada.

Bastará con descargar la carpeta de tu plantilla del antiguo hosting (raiz/wp-contents/themes/) y subirla al nuevo hosting.

Si haces una comprobación, observarás que ya tienes una copia idéntica de tu web en otro hosting a la que le hemos quitado aquellas tablas obsoletas.

Ahora queda uno de los pasos más importantes, cambiar las DNS de tu dominio para que apunte al nuevo servidor.

Cambiar las DNS de un domino al trasladar wordpress de servidor

Antes de nada, es acceder a nuestra antigua instalación de Wordpress, que aún está disponible desde nuestro dominio, y en Ajustes/Lectura marcamos la opción de no ser rastreada por los motores de búsqueda.

Ahora llega el turno de sustituir la tabla wp-options de nuestra nueva instalación de Wordpress por la tabla de la antigua instalación.

Trasladar wordpress de servidor
Comprobación de las DNS de un dominio

Una vez hecho comprobarás que ya no puedes acceder a tu nueva instalación de Wordpress ya que ahora necesitamos que tu dominio apunte a ella.

Desde el hosting o servicio donde tenemos contratado nuestro dominio, accedemos a su gestión y editamos las DNS o Nameservers poniendo aquellas DNS que nos facilitó Webempresa al darnos de alta.

Ten en cuenta que la propagación de las DNS puede demorar en hasta 24 horas, así que conveniente realizar el cambio en aquellas horas en las que el tráfico de nuestra web es menor.

Comprobar que un dominio apunta al servidor

Es muy simple, bastará con abrir una consola de comandos (Inicio de Windows/Ejecutar/cmd) y escribimos el comando ping seguido de nuestro dominio.

La ip de respuesta que obtenemos debe ser la que nuestro nuevo servidor.

¿Quieres que te avise cuando alguien te responda?
Avisar de

1 Comentario
Inline Feedbacks
Ver todos los comentarios
CubeNode
26/03/2018 10:50

¡¡Viva!! Gracias por esta guía, me ha funcionado a la perfección 😉 Es muy práctica y fácil de seguir, que es mucho decir con este tipo de cosas. ¡Enhorabuena por el blog!